問題:. MCS-51系列單片機的引腳中有多少根I/O線?它們與單片機對外的地址總線和數(shù)據(jù)總線之間有什么關系?其地址總線和數(shù)據(jù)總線各有多少位?對外可尋址的地址空間有多大?
解答:80C51單片機有4個I/O端口,每個端口都是8位雙向口,共占32根引腳。每個端口都包括一個鎖存器(即專用寄存器P0~P3)、一個輸入驅動器和輸入緩沖器。通常把4個端口稱為P0~P3。在無片外擴展的存儲器的系統(tǒng)中,這4個端口的每一位都可以作為雙向通用I/O端口使用。在具有片外擴展存儲器的系統(tǒng)中,P2口作為高8位地址線,P0口分時作為低8位地址線和雙向數(shù)據(jù)總線。